tiprankstipranks
Logan Ridge Finance (LRFC)
NASDAQ:LRFC
United States
LRFCLogan Ridge Finance
$25.11
-$0.17(-0.66%)
At close: 4:00 PM EST
$24.98
-$0.13(-0.51%)
After hours: Nov 20 4:00 PM EST